Output 04212cd64e5defe20fa2f0601ffe92526a70b4f3785b3d3ad7a4d2c6e5fcf70b:0

value
586000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e574c82256a638ac56c562c22ab06b26e5127d50 OP_EQUAL
address
3NcGZcVoENnw7mzdBWKHgsxtLdxaxbjzUa
transaction
04212cd64e5defe20fa2f0601ffe92526a70b4f3785b3d3ad7a4d2c6e5fcf70b
confirmations
160706
spent
true